One of our day excursions was to Tehachapi. It is a nice mountainy town and my Aunt Bev lives there. We enjoy having lunch at a Bakery there and this time we thought we'd check out "The Loop". The Loop is just that ... the grade is so steep at this point that the railroad built a loop for the trains to go around so that they could gradually go down the mountain ... it is supposedly one of the 7 railroad wonders of the world. Anyway, we found a scenic overlook and parked there to wait for the train. We pulled out lawn chairs and bottled water and settled in. Normally the trains come by pretty frequently, but for some reason on this particular day they weren't as frequent. We waited about an hour before the train came. It made its loop and we packed up and headed home. It was kind of anticlimactic, but at least we can say we saw it! In any case, we got to spend the day with Aunt Bev and that was worth it!
